A brief of > >>>>> what he discussed with Raihanaji is as follows :- > >>>>> > >>>>> " Hi. This is Vijay. I am from Mumbai, just moved to Chennai. I was a > >>>>> big fan of AR, then became a friend of him, and its my good fortune that I > >>>>> work for him now. I am based in Chennai now. Rahman has announced his new > >>>>> music label, which is called KM Music. Its a music company. I manage the > >>>>> Label. I also do other things like managing the content of his website , lot > >>>>> of creative stuff etc . > >>>>> > >>>>> Km Music has been Rahman 's dream, and he has mentioned this in a lot > >>>>> of his interviews. The Kind of music he likes... Nowadays, if you see, all > >>>>> sort of music is commercialised. and music sales is not that much. > >>>>> Basically, a film which has 4 or 5 Kutthu songs are become the pick of the > >>>>> day ( This was told by Raihannaji), and thats what sells ( told by Vijay) . > >>>>> There needs to be a market for true Music Lovers, and Rahman shares that > >>>>> feeling, and this label of his will give an opportunity for him as well as > >>>>> other musicians to explore what is not within commercial parameters. > >>>>> > >>>>> Almost from the time, Roja got released, I have been a fan. ( Very nice singing from Vijay... > >>>>> :-)) > >>>>> > >>>>> *Transformation into a Friend of Rahman* > >>>>> > >>>>> Its an interesting story. In 1994, when I came to Chennai, through you, > >>>>> I met Rahman. After that, I wasnt been able to be in touch with him, as I > >>>>> was in Bombay, and he was in Chennai. There were no cell phones or emails at > >>>>> that time. After my studies, I took up a job. I was lucky enough, as in one > >>>>> of my jobs, I used to frequently travel abroad. That was the time, in > >>>>> 2000-01, when Rahman was doing Bombay Dreams in London. so, one day, when I > >>>>> was travelling to London. I saw Sir in Bombay Airport. I ran towards him, > >>>>> and asked him, if he remembered me, when I had met him up in 94, and he > >>>>> told, " NO.". So, i thought that this was the opportunity, as no one would > >>>>> disturb him, in the plane. No Directors, nor producers. For the full 8 hrs, > >>>>> I spoke with him, in the similar manner as I am speaking with you now. I > >>>>> told him abt how I bought his cassettes, Internet Community etc . Next day, > >>>>> in London airport, I told him, I was free the entire day. If you dont mind, > >>>>> can I come with you. He just saw me and he thought that this is a crazy > >>>>> fan, but was really convinced, that I was really genuine. I had the fear > >>>>> that many like me, would have gone to him, seeking his autograph, photos > >>>>> etc. But I think, there is some connection. It can be said as Destiny. He > >>>>> agreed, and he took me with him to the place where he stayed in London. he > >>>>> was happy, by seeing the Internet community, and he himself gave his email > >>>>> id, and his phone number and said, " Keep in touch". and then, we were in > >>>>> touch regularly. Whenever he used to come to Mumbai,. I was lucky enough to > >>>>> drive him to the studios, been there for recordings etc > >>>>> > >>>>> We became close friends. This is really Blessings of the Almighty. > >>>>> There are millions of people waiting for a chance like this. I dont know, > >>>>> how I got a chance like this. Right from the beginning, the fascination to > >>>>> be with him, and do anything for him has been there in my heart. At that > >>>>> time, he was planning to open a new studios in Chennai by name A.M. studios. > >>>>> He was looking for someone to manage the studios. So, he asked me to come to > >>>>> Chennai, have a look at it. But that didnt work out. After that, we did a > >>>>> lot of write ups, and convinced him on making a website. I used to keep > >>>>> telling him, " Sir. I want to do something for you, with you. ". Its a > >>>>> passion, thats why. > >>>>> > >>>>> One day, he called me and said, " Meet me at 5 in the morning". I went > >>>>> at 5 in the morning. He said, " I am planning to start a new music label , > >>>>> and I think you can do it. You come to Chennai".
